What is the next term of the arithmetic sequence?<br> -2, 3, 8, 13, 18,
Aneli [31]

Answer:

\boxed{\boxed{\sf~a_6=23}}

Solution Steps:

This is an arithmetic sequence since there is a common difference between each term. In this case, adding 5 to the previous term in the sequence gives the next term. In other words, a_n=a_1+d(n-1).

Arithmetic Sequence: d=5

Find the next term using the Arithmetic Sequence.

Arithmetic Sequence: a_6=a_5+5

a_6=18+5=23

A population of 3000 people doubles in size every 10 years. Determine the population after 50 years.
RUDIKE [14]

Answer:

In 50 years Population is 96000 people.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let population be x

In the first 10 years

Population becomes 2x

In 20 years it becomes 4x

In 10n years it becomes 2^n x

Therefore

for n= 5

x = 3000

Population is 2⁵ (3000)

= 32(3000)

= 96000

Population becomes 96000

The number sentence 4x6=6x4 is an example of the what property
monitta

Answer:

commutative property of multiplication

Step-by-step explanation:

The value of the product of the given equation remain the same while the order is reversed

The number sequence 4 × 6 = 6 × 4 is an example of the commutative property of multiplication

Reason:

The given number sentence is 4 × 6 = 6 × 4

Required: The property the number sentence is an example of (represent)

Solution:

The difference between the left and right expression is that the order of the

values being multiplied is changed or reversed (commute)

Therefore, the number sentence states that the value of the multiplication

of two variables remain equal when the places of variables are

interchanged as follows; a × b = b × a

a × b = b × a is an example of commutative property of multiplication

Therefore;

4 × 6 = 6 × 4 is an example of the commutative property of multiplication
